Why This Viral Treat Has Everyone Hooked

The Dubai chocolate bar exploded on platforms like TikTok, drawing in millions with its unique mix of Middle Eastern flavors. People couldn’t stop sharing videos of the gooey pistachio center and the crispy kadayif strands that add that perfect snap. It’s not just candy; it’s an experience that feels indulgent yet playful.

Hershey’s noticed the frenzy and decided to jump in. Their version keeps the essence but makes it accessible with classic American chocolate. Released today, it’s aimed straight at younger crowds who live for these trendy bites.

What sets it apart? The limited run creates urgency, turning a simple snack into a collector’s item. Fans are already lining up online, eager to taste the hype.

The Secret Ingredients Behind the Magic

At its core, this bar blends Hershey’s signature milk chocolate with a pistachio cream that’s smooth and nutty. Then comes the kadayif – those thin, shredded pastry threads fried to golden crispness. Together, they mimic the original Dubai style but with a twist that’s easier on the wallet.

Priced at $8.99, it’s a steal compared to imported versions that can cost double. Hershey’s team spent months perfecting the balance so the crunch doesn’t overpower the sweetness. It’s designed for sharing, whether you’re splitting it with friends or savoring it solo.

How to Get Your Hands on One Before They’re Gone

Starting December 4th at 10 a.m. ET, these bars go live exclusively through the GoPuff app in select cities like New York. You’ll need to act fast since the stock vanishes in minutes. Hershey’s Chocolate World online is another spot to check, but quantities are tiny.

What Makes This More Than Just a Fad

Beyond the buzz, Hershey’s move shows how big brands adapt to global tastes. The pistachio and kadayif combo draws from knafeh, a beloved dessert in the Middle East, bringing diverse flavors to everyday shelves. It’s a win for cultural crossover in snacking.
